This report proposes a data augmentation method to improve the accuracy of fine-grained temporal action segmentation in laparoscopic surgery videos. Unlike previous methods that applied faster scaling (e.g., 2 × or higher), the proposed method enables slower temporal changes, such as scaling to 1.5 ×. This augmentation is selectively applied only to segments whose lengths exceed the average segment length of their respective action classes. We demonstrate the effectiveness of the proposed approach by applying it to MS-TCN, MS-TCN++, and their ensemble model.
